Product Structure
|
Layer |
Material |
Thickness |
Key Function |
|
Inner Anti-corrosion Layer (Optional) |
Polymer (e.g., PVC) |
- |
Full-wrap protection against internal condensation; ideal for high-humidity & chemical environments |
|
Metal Skeleton (Core Structural Layer) |
Cold-rolled steel / galvanized strip steel |
≥1.5mm (width ≤200mm) |
Provides mechanical strength and load-bearing capacity; ensures no deflection under heavy loads and long spans |
|
Bonding Layer |
Special adhesive medium |
≥0.2mm |
Bonds steel and plastic securely; prevents delamination over decades of use |
|
Main Anti-corrosion & Flame-retardant Layer |
PVC, modified polyethylene, polypropylene, or composite epoxy resin |
≥2.0mm |
Primary corrosion protection and flame retardancy (oxygen index ≥36%) |
|
Protective Layer (Outermost) |
Modified high-performance polymer |
- |

Key Product Advantages
Why Choose Polymer composite cable tray with steel-plastic?
They combine the strength of steel cable trays with the durability of PVC cable trays.
- Strong Corrosion Resistance - The polymer outer layer effectively resists moisture, chemicals, and salt spray. Especially in corrosive environments such as chemical plants and coastal facilities, it prevents rusting or pitting.
- High Load Capacity - The Polymer composite cable tray adopts a steel-plastic inner steel frame, which has the mechanical strength to withstand large cable loads and can support large span installations (up to 12-15 meters) without sagging or deformation.
- Long Service Life - A service life of over 30 years. In corrosive environments, its service life is 3-5 times that of traditional cable trays. It requires almost no maintenance, significantly reducing the total life cycle cost.
- Reliable Flame Retardancy - The outer polymer layer has an oxygen index ≥36%, achieving a B1 or V-0 flame retardant rating, thus significantly improving fire safety.

FAQ
Q: What is the difference between steel-plastic composite cable trays and traditional steel cable trays?
A: The polymer composite cable tray with steel-plastic design overcomes the inherent shortcomings of metal. By preserving the rigidity of the metal skeleton while incorporating a high-performance polymer coating, it effectively resolves common issues plaguing metal trays, including corrosion susceptibility, inadequate insulation, heavy deadweight, and high lifecycle maintenance. Suitable for diverse applications across chemical, municipal, construction, and industrial sectors, it delivers stable performance that helps reduce overall engineering costs and enhance power supply safety.
Q: Where Can High Polymer Composite Cable Trays Be Used?
A: The polymer composite cable trays are suitable for industrial, commercial, infrastructure, and outdoor applications, including factories, commercial buildings, data centers, rail transit, ports, airports, and renewable energy facilities. Their corrosion resistance and durable construction also make them suitable for installations exposed to moisture, weather, salt spray, and corrosive environments.
Q: Can Polymer composite cable tray with steel-plastic be used in chemical plants?
A: Yes. Steel-plastic polymer composite cable trays are suitable for many chemical plant applications where high corrosion resistance and electrical insulation are required. Their high-performance polymer outer layer provides effective resistance to moisture, chemical vapors, and various corrosive media. As chemical environments vary, material selection should consider factors such as the type and concentration of chemicals and the operating temperature.
